There are a variety of different kinds of mesothelioma lawsuits victims and their families can make. Personal injury, wrongful death, and trust funds are all possible claims. Most mesothelioma cases are filed as a single case, not in an action that is a class. It is because mesothelioma patients are compensated more in individual lawsuits. After a lawsuit is settled, the money will be disbursed to the plaintiffs. If medical providers have imposed liens on their patients, these have to be paid prior the funds being released.

There are three different types of mesothelioma claims that include personal injury, wrongful death, and trust fund claim. A personal injury lawsuit seeks redress from the defendant that caused the illness. This is the most popular form of mesothelioma case. Patients' families may claim wrongful deaths to seek compensation from the company(ies) responsible for the victim’s death. A claim for compensation from a mesothelioma trust fund is filed with one of the many asbestos trust funds established by the government or asbestos companies.

Asbestos manufacturers have hidden the dangers they pose in their products for years, causing many victims to suffer. They knew that asbestos caused illness and death, but they continued to use the material in their buildings, ships, vehicles and homes. These companies are now in bankruptcy and their assets have been put into trust funds. These trust funds give money to mesothelioma patients, asbestosis patients and other asbestos-related diseases.
